One-Pan Chicken Alfredo Orzo Creamy Skillet Dinner
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ings
Description
Creamy skillet chicken served over Parmesan alfredo orzo made in one pan.
Ingredients
2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
1/2 teaspoon garlic salt
1/2 teaspoon paprika
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 cup dry orzo pasta, cooked
1/4 cup unsalted butter
2 teaspoons minced garlic
1 1/2 cups heavy cream
1 1/2 cups finely grated Parmesan cheese
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on black pepper
Chopped fresh parsley
Instructions
1. Season chicken evenly.
2. Cook chicken in olive oil until done.
3. Rest chicken.
4. Melt butter and sauté garlic.
5. Add cream and simmer.
6. Stir in Parmesan and seasoning.
7. Mix in cooked orzo.
8. Slice chicken and serve over orzo.
Notes
Grate Parmesan finely for smooth sauce. Reheat gently with extra cream.

Cooking Method Made Simple
Skillet techniques for One-Pan Chicken Alfredo Orzo
Using medium-high heat for the chicken builds color while keeping the interior moist. Resting the chicken briefly helps retain juices before slicing.
Sauce control in One-Pan Chicken Alfredo Orzo
Lower heat during the sauce stage prevents separation. Stirring continuously ensures the Parmesan integrates evenly into the cream.
Orzo texture tips for One-Pan Chicken Alfredo Orzo
Cooking the orzo just until tender prevents it from becoming mushy once combined with the sauce. Stir gently to maintain structure.

Variations and Customizations
Protein swaps for One-Pan Chicken Alfredo Orzo
Shrimp or turkey cutlets can replace chicken without changing the method. Adjust cooking time to prevent overcooking.
Vegetable add-ins for One-Pan Chicken Alfredo Orzo
Spinach, peas, or sautéed mushrooms integrate easily. Stir them in at the end so they retain color and texture.
Lightened versions of One-Pan Chicken Alfredo Orzo
